A Navy Wife

She lived in 40 homes, raised four children, "kept the books and made life rich in tiny nooks," her husband wrote a few years ago in a poem titled "Tribute to A Golden Partner."

You raised morale on many ships, solved many family problems on ocean trips.

"She was an important member of the official party, meeting with Navy wives, American and allied, helping them with their problems, raising their spirits, and calling my attention to many things I had no other way of finding out about," Zumwalt said of his loving wife, Mouza Coutelais-du-Roche Zumwalt.

From her obituary in the Washington Post after her death on 25 August 2005.
